Fresh off his PowerShell Wednesday presentation, David shares insights into the power of &lt;em&gt;splatting&lt;/em&gt; in PowerShell, centralizing automations, and driving organizational change through best practices and leadership. The conversation explores the evolution of automation practices, Git adoption in Ops, secrets management using Azure Key Vault, and how empowering others can multiply technical impact. It’s an inspiring blend of deep PowerShell knowledge and practical career development advice.&lt;/p&gt;</description></item></channel></rss>
